Objectives: This retrospective study sought to assess the clinical and angiographic long-term outcome after implanting drug-eluting stents in bifurcation lesions with the T-provisional (T-prov) technique and mini-crush (MC) technique. Background: The best option on the treatment of coronary bifurcation lesions is a subject of considerable debate. However, recent evidence suggests that bifurcation lesions might be treated by drug-eluting stent on both branches using the MC technique with a low rate of major adverse cardiac event and restenosis. ABSTRACT Objectives: To assess plaque and gingivitis reduction in orthodontic patients after 4 weeks' use of an oscillating-rotating power brush, irrigator, and mouthrinse. Materials and Methods: This was a randomized, examiner-blind, clinical trial comparing plaque and gingivitis outcomes for an experimental power brush/irrigator/mouthrinse oral hygiene routine vs a dental prophylaxis followed by regular manual brushing (positive control). Fifty-one participants with fixed orthodontic appliances in the upper and lower jaw and a minimum of 15 gingival bleeding sites were randomly assigned to experimental or positive control treatment. Long-term care of older adults is currently suffering from a shortage of trained personnel and high turnover rates. Care work is poorly paid, demanding, increasingly time-bound and both mentally and physically burdensome. In this study, we examined the individual, organisational and economic factors that predict professional care workers’ intentions to leave their current employment, using the NORDCARE survey data (2015, N = 3801) collected in Denmark, Finland, Norway and Sweden. The respondents were mainly practical and assistant nurses. The analysis showed that the predictors of intentions to leave were similar in the four countries. We present the synthesis of reactive polymer brushes prepared by surface reversible addition–fragmentation chain transfer polymerization of pentafluorophenyl acrylate. The reactive ester moieties can be used to functionalize the polymer brush film with virtually any functionality by simple post-polymerization modification with amines. Dithiobenzoic acid benzyl-(4-ethyltrimethoxylsilyl) ester was used as the surface chain transfer agent (S-CTA) and the anchoring group onto the silicon substrates. Reactive polymer brushes with adjustable molecular weight, high grafting density, and conformal coverage through the grafting-from approach were obtained. In this paper, we describe a strategy to overcome incompatibility of colloidal particles and polymer coils as well as immiscibility of spherical and rod-shaped nanoparticles. Two new types of model colloids are presented, colloidal nanospheres with hairy surfaces (spherical brushes) and polymacromonomers to represent cylindrical brushes. The spherical brushes are synthesized from polyorganosiloxane-μ-gels of diameter 20 nm by grafting onto anionically prepared polystyrene macromonomers of molecular weight M w=5000 g/mol. We study the effective interaction between two parallel rod-like nanoparticles in swollen and collapsed polymer brushes as a function of penetration depth by 2D self-consistent field calculations. In vertical direction, the interaction is always attractive. In lateral direction, the behavior under good and poor solvent conditions is qualitatively different. In swollen brushes (good solvent), nanoparticles always repel each other. In collapsed brushes (poor solvent), we identify two different regimes: an immersed regime, where the nanoparticles are fully surrounded by the brush, and an interfacial regime, where they are located in the interface between brush and solvent. Previous molecular dynamics simulations of friction between polymer brushes in relative sliding motion [Kreer, T.; Muser, M. H.; Binder, K.; Klein, J. Langmuir 2001, 17, 7804] are extended beyond steady-state conditions. We study two different protocols:  (i) stop and return and (ii) stop and go. In protocol (i), the relative, lateral motion between the two surfaces is stopped abruptly and reimposed opposite to the initial direction after the system could relax for some time. Protocol (ii) is similar except that the sliding direction is maintained.
